**infamous n55 torque dip**
For the past year we have been noticing the horrible torque dip when dynoing the n55 motor.
Terry's n55 135i Notice the dip after 3krpms Shiv's n55 135i Notice dip right after 2krpms And here is mine 335i with ar design downpipe Scary I know. A few people have asked why there is such a dramatic drop in tq, which led me to review my dynos. After comparing AFR with tq I have come to the conclusion that for some unknown reason the engine is running extra lean through those rpms.. Notice the huge drop in tq and how the car seems to lean out and start dropping again around 3700rpms and torque is restored. *note that was a 4th gear pull* These next pulls were done in 3rd gear with the now we have the first flashed n55 in the US. It isn't easy to see but it does appear that they have better control of the AFR and have a much nicer tq curve with their flash. This car can run and it pulls hard. I can see this car hitting 11's and trapping over 120 really easy. I hit a 12.95@107 with a 12.8psi max and thats with an extremely slow track(friend with n54 FBO, dual meath, race fuel was trapping 115 all night with a 12.09 1/4). I can only hope that shiv, terry, and or cobb can grasp the fueling issue soon. It obviously has already been down with a flash but I don't see myself sending my ecu to florida anytime soon. I guess I'll just sit back and wait till the n54 war is over and tuners can come back and give a little focus to the n55.

i think is a boost adaptation issue because the car doesn't do than on the road , it seems to do this because a boost overshoot and sub-sequent wastegate duty cycle reduction.
i'm going to see if i can make it to the dyno tomorrow and i'll have some logs of the dyno runs and street runs so we all can compare. BTW, did i mention my car is trapping 114.xx with 2.6 60' ?!? the flash car run doesn't get richer then stock till 3500 RPM...if it was the case that the dip is caused because of a lean condition then i would have exepected the flash run to be richer sooner in the RPM range.
